Abstract
Istotą wynalazku jest zintegrowany przyrząd do oceny rozkładu grubości osadu kamiennego w układach hydraulicznych, stanowiący fragment tego układu hydraulicznego, który składa się z części (A) i części (B), tworzących kształtkę hydrauliczną o przekroju poprzecznym okrągłym i wewnętrznej średnicy (d), wewnątrz której osadzony jest rozłącznie ustrój pomiarowy (P) zbudowany z dwóch bocznych wsporników mocujących, lewego i prawego, o przekroju poprzecznym okrągłym i wewnętrznej średnicy (d), pomiędzy którymi osadzone są współosiowo pierścień pomiarowy, o wewnętrznej średnicy (d) oraz tuleja mocująca, przy czym tuleja mocująca ma większą średnicę od średnicy pierścienia pomiarowego, natomiast na zewnętrznej powierzchni pierścienia pomiarowego, osadzone są dookoła dwie grzałki opaskowe, gdzie każda grzałka opaskowa zawiera zwoje drutu elektrooporowego, a pomiędzy obiema grzałkami opaskowymi posadowione są promieniowo co najmniej dwa czujniki temperatury, których końce pomiarowe (e) są osadzone w nieprzelotowych otworach ścianki pierścienia pomiarowego, ponadto część (A) posiada wewnętrzne wybranie o średnicy wewnętrznej (dw) i płaszczyźnie bocznej (pA), a cześć (B) posiada występ pozycjonujący o średnicy zewnętrznej (dz) i płaszczyźnie bocznej (pB), gdzie ustrój pomiarowy (P) umieszczony jest pomiędzy płaszczyzną boczną (pA) wybrania części (A) a płaszczyzną boczna (pB) występu pozycjonującego części (B), natomiast część (A) połączona jest rozłącznie z częścią (B) korzystnie śrubami poprzez kołnierze stałe, ponadto cześć (A) posiada na jednym końcu gwint albo kołnierz, a część (B) posiada na jednym końcu gwint albo kołnierz stały.The essence of the invention is an integrated device for assessing the distribution of scale deposit thickness in hydraulic systems, constituting a part of this hydraulic system, which consists of part (A) and part (B), forming a hydraulic fitting with a circular cross-section and an internal diameter (d), inside which a measuring system (P) is releasably mounted, composed of two lateral mounting brackets, left and right, with a circular cross-section and an internal diameter (d), between which a measuring ring with an internal diameter (d) and a mounting sleeve are mounted coaxially, wherein the mounting sleeve has a larger diameter than the diameter of the measuring ring, while on the outer surface of the measuring ring, two band heaters are mounted around them, where each band heater contains coils of electrofusion wire, and between both band heaters at least two temperature sensors are mounted radially, the measuring ends of which (e) are mounted in blind holes in the wall of the measuring ring, furthermore part (A) has an internal recess with an internal diameter (dw) and a lateral plane (pA), and part (B) has a positioning projection with an external diameter (dz) and a lateral plane (pB), wherein the measuring system (P) is placed between the lateral plane (pA) of the recess of part (A) and the lateral plane (pB) of the positioning projection of part (B), while part (A) is releasably connected to part (B), preferably by screws via fixed flanges, furthermore part (A) has a thread or a flange at one end, and part (B) has a thread or a fixed flange at one end.
